Yam Ki Chan
Vice President, Asia Pacific
Circle
Yam Ki Chan is the Vice President for Asia Pacific of Circle (NYSE: CRCL), responsible for the company’s business and strategy in the region. He leads a team responsible for partnerships and market expansion across the region. He advises stakeholders on how stablecoins unlock economic opportunities for businesses and economies. He also serves as the Managing Director of Circle Singapore. He oversaw the enablement of USDC in Japan, the first stablecoin recognized in the country. Prior to Circle, he held strategy & operations and public policy roles at Google Payments and Google Cloud, where he worked on partnership strategy, market launches, and government affairs. Before Google, he served as a Director at the White House National Security Council, where he coordinated U.S. economic strategy in Asia and was a member of the U.S. negotiations team for the G-20 and G-7. Before joining the National Security Council staff, he worked in the U.S. Department of the Treasury’s Office of the U.S.-China Strategic and Economic Dialogue and the Committee on Foreign Investment in the United States. Earlier in his career, he worked in technology investment banking at Jefferies in Silicon Valley. He earned a Master of International Affairs from Columbia University and a Bachelor’s degree in Economics from Carleton College.
